flag Pennsylvania town gets $48M tax breaks to attract musicians, sparking debate on corporate welfare.

flag Pennsylvania's Rock Lititz has received $48 million in state tax breaks through the Entertainment Economic Enhancement Program (EEEP), aimed at attracting musicians for rehearsals and performances. flag The program, introduced in 2016, has seen tax credits sold to businesses like insurance companies and banks, offsetting their state taxes. flag Critics argue the program is corporate welfare, while supporters note it brings investment and jobs. flag The Independent Fiscal Office recommends making the tax credit refundable to boost economic impact.
